Course structure

• Historical Overview of Colonialism • Impact of Colonialism on Indigenous Cultures • Key Figures in Social Justice Movements • Intersectionality in Colonialism and Social Justice • Decolonization Strategies and Practices • Advocacy and Activism in Social Justice Movements • Indigenous Rights and Land Sovereignty • Global Perspectives on Colonialism and Social Justice • Ethical Considerations in Anti-Colonial and Social Justice Work
